    I am not sure about how permaNET provide a VoIP service, but blueface do offer a reseller solution for ISP's. You are probably going through Blueface if your extension begins with 3XXXX- and can be reached through 015242025.

    Provided that the Philips VOIP8551B connects through SIP, than there is no problem, you can receive/send both inbound and outbound calls. You will need the SIP account information though.

    If the service is done through blueface, than its likely sip based. That phone you have is a basic phone that connects to your router.

    The question is , Can I use the the Philips VOIP8551B and place outgoing calls with my permaNET service as I have a feeling SIP part is done on the permaNET router

    That phone appears to be a Skype & PSTN phone, not a SIP VOIP phone.

    I guess it might work using the PSTN side to make calls through the PermaTel SIP line ....... but Permanet are the ones to ask ......
